Greektown located in Downtown Detroit, decorated with casinos, bars and clubs attracts the crowd once the sky gets dark.

Every night folks from the city and from other parts of Michigan flock to the place to try their luck at the poker, grab a drink, enjoy a walk on the European style streets or to do the thing which excites the most: Party!

The place has a couple of good restaurants too. Be it the “Five Guys” which is famous for offering fries made from fresh potatoes directly from the field, or be it the fine dining sites, Food-o-holics love this place.

To enter in casino or clubs one must be at least 21 years old, otherwise get ready to be disappointed by the security official’s rude “NO”. (I myself was denied 3 times)


The area is safe, thanks to the Detroit Police department for their patrolling. Students from different nearby universities love to come on weekends, to re-fuel and get ready for the week ahead.
